The Guide for Educators, the 3rd component of ACIM, is aimed at those who have embraced the principles of the Class and sense compelled to fairly share them with others. It gives guidance on the faculties of a real instructor of God, emphasizing characteristics such as for example patience, confidence, and an open heart. It acknowledges the challenges and obstacles one might experience while training the Course and offers ideas on the best way to navigate them.

It’s crucial that you recognize that A Program in Miracles hasn’t been without their experts and controversies. Some have asked the authenticity of their authorship, as Helen Schucman said to own acquired the writing through an activity of inner dictation from the religious source she identified as Jesus. Skeptics argue that the text may be considered a item of her own mind as opposed to heavenly revelation. Furthermore, the Course’s heavy and abstract language can be quite a barrier for some visitors, making it hard to know its concepts.
